What are the reasons for the sudden interruption of hydraulic forklifts

releaseTime:2025-08-27 09:33:05source:Mu TiannumberOfPageViews:0

The sudden interruption of hydraulic forklift operation during use may be caused by hydraulic system failure, electrical system failure, mechanical component failure, improper operation, or environmental factors. The specific reasons and analysis are as follows:

1、 Hydraulic system malfunction

Hydraulic oil problem:

Insufficient hydraulic oil: Hydraulic oil is the power source for the operation of hydraulic forklifts. If the oil level is insufficient, it will cause insufficient system pressure and prevent the forklift from operating normally.

Hydraulic oil contamination: Impurities, moisture, or air mixed into hydraulic oil can reduce its performance, leading to unstable system pressure or component damage. For example, impurities may block the throttle hole, increase the resistance of the slide valve, and slow the response of the mechanism.

Excessive hydraulic oil temperature: Excessive hydraulic oil temperature can lead to a decrease in oil viscosity, reduced lubrication performance, accelerated component wear, and even system failure. Excessive oil temperature may be caused by insufficient oil quantity, poor oil quality, oil pump intake, or internal system leaks.

Hydraulic pump malfunction:

Wear and tear of hydraulic pump: The hydraulic pump is the core component of the hydraulic system. If it is severely worn, it can lead to insufficient pressure or inability to generate pressure, making the forklift unable to operate normally.

Hydraulic pump intake: Hydraulic pump intake can cause unstable system pressure and even cause forklift stalling. The intake may be caused by aging seals, ruptured oil pipes, or internal leaks in the oil pump.

Hydraulic valve malfunction:

Overflow valve malfunction: The overflow valve is used to control the maximum pressure of the hydraulic system. If the malfunction occurs, it may cause the system pressure to be too high or too low, affecting the normal operation of the forklift.

Fault in directional valve: The directional valve is used to control the flow of hydraulic oil. If the fault occurs, it may cause the forklift to operate abnormally or fail to operate.

Hydraulic cylinder malfunction:

Internal leakage of hydraulic cylinder: Internal leakage of hydraulic cylinder can cause a decrease in system pressure, resulting in slow or ineffective forklift operation. Leakage may be caused by aging seals, scratches on piston rods, or wear on cylinder barrels.

Inconsistent stroke of hydraulic cylinder: If the stroke of two tilting cylinders is inconsistent, it may cause the gantry to tilt out of sync, affecting the stability of the forklift.

2、 Electrical system malfunction

Power issue:

Insufficient battery power: Insufficient battery power can cause the forklift to fail to start or experience sudden interruptions during operation.

Poor contact of power switch: Poor contact of power switch may cause interruption of forklift circuit and prevent normal operation.

Electrical component malfunction:

Fuse blowing: Fuses are used to protect circuits, and if blown, they may cause interruptions in the forklift circuit.

Contactor failure: The contactor is used to control the on/off of the circuit. If the fault occurs, it may cause the forklift to fail to start or suddenly interrupt during operation.

3、 Mechanical component failure

Transmission component malfunction:

Clutch slippage: Clutch slippage may cause interruption of forklift power transmission and prevent normal operation.

Gearbox malfunction: Worn gears or damaged bearings inside the gearbox may cause abnormal or interrupted forklift operation.

Brake component malfunction:

Brake stuck: Brake stuck may cause the forklift to malfunction or stop.

Brake fluid leakage: Brake fluid leakage can cause brake system failure and affect forklift safety.

4、 Improper operation or environmental factors

Improper operation:

Overloading operation: Overloading operation can cause forklift components to bear excessive loads, accelerate wear or damage.

Sudden braking or sharp turning: Sudden braking or sharp turning may cause excessive force on forklift components, leading to malfunctions.

Environmental factors:

High temperature environment: High temperature environment can cause hydraulic oil temperature to rise, performance to decline, and lead to system failures.

Damp environment: A damp environment may cause electrical components to become damp and short-circuit, leading to circuit failures.
